Output 18b13ee139073f6a699eee42ad02acb38f93efc501966c97d72a90f7a7a7642d:0

value
352004593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52211579b4d76330a78ca1c8680d945c79c6380b OP_EQUAL
address
39BGxyx63GEFSisn4aPizpU12x4Vs8AQ2s
transaction
18b13ee139073f6a699eee42ad02acb38f93efc501966c97d72a90f7a7a7642d
confirmations
301899
spent
true